Like rotation programs, large businesses most often feature leadership development programs, but you can occasionally find a small business with an opening or two for a leadership development-type position. These programs last anywhere from six months to two years, and the type of work you do in such a program varies widely depending on department.
You’ll need a bachelor’s degree in a related field to enter most leadership development programs. While leadership development programs are designed for new graduates, experience gained through internships and part-time jobs will strengthen your application.
